Name: | Ridge and furrow in Wray Cleave Wood |
---|
Summary
Recorded in walkover survey in 1985; area of ridge and furrow in south end of Wray Cleave. Ridges 6.5 metres wide.0.5 metres trough to crest (maximum). Lynchet along southern part of western edge of area.

Full description
McCrone, P., 1985, An Archaeological Survey of Some Dartmoor Woodlands, 7, WC12, fig 3 (Report - Survey). SDV360479.
Ridge and furrow - SX 7747 8408
The area covered by ridge and furrow is some 200m by 40m. The eastern uphill edge appears to have been partly obliterated by the access track bulldozed through the wood. On the downhill edge a negative lynchet exists at the southern end. The ridges are around 6.5m wide and have axes running north-east by south-west. A field some 100m south of the wood (around SX 776 836) has traces of ridge and furrow cultivation which were revealed by light snow cover in January 1985.
